Hertelendy Vineyards The Best is Yet to Come

Ralph Hertelendy traces his wine heritage back several generations to Hungary, to wines produced by his great uncle Gabor Hertelendy. You could say that wine making was always part of Ralph’s DNA, and when he decided to become a winemaker, his goal was twofold: to honor his family history and to produce the highest quality wine possible. The family name “Hertelendy” on the bottle is more than just a name-it is a tribute to family and his past-and a commitment to the future.

Person Extraordinaire This is a man who is driven by an exuberance and passion for life. He is an accomplished pianist, a sports enthusiast who loves golfing, snowboarding, skydiving, and driving fast cars (on a racetrack). He speaks five languages (and remarks, he can “get by” in Hungarian). He is an artist (designing his own labels), a realtor, and philanthropist, being active in his family’s non-profit organization, The Hertelendy Foundation. With all his endeavors, Ralph channels incredible energy and passion into winemaking, striving towards excellence, while always challenging himself to be better. His love affair with wine began at an early age, when he saw, at his parent’s dinner parties, how wine simply brought

people together, and made them smile. That became Ralph’s goal, to make wines that are complex, intriguing, and will make people smile. In doing so, he brings something special into other people’s lives through his wine. As Ralph remarks, with a smile and ever-present twinkle in his eyes, “when someone sips my wine, I want to blow their mind.”

In The Beginning In his early thirties, Ralph was brash and “somewhat” arrogant. However, recognizing these traits, he sought out a consulting winemaker who would be able to temper him, teach him and meld distinctive styles and philosophies to produce great wines. Ralph found such a person in Phillip Corallo-Titus, head winemaker at Chappellet. Ralph knew intuitively this would be a perfect fit, blending personalities and styles. This was born out when Hertelendy’s initial 2013 vintage Cabernet Sauvignon was released in 2015. Instantly recognized by Robert Parker with a score of 95, Parker stated “…this wine merits serious attention.” Ralph Hertelendy was on his way establishing himself as one of Napa’s premier winemakers. Together, Ralph and Phillip create wines that reflect elegance and harmony. WINE COUNTRY THIS WEEK

10/5/21 12:29 PM


2021 – An Excellent Vintage Hertelendy Vineyards sources its fruit, not just from its 28-year-old, 1365-feet-elevation “Rockwell Ridge” estate vineyard (35 feet below Howell Mountain AVA), but also from ultra premium vineyards around the Napa Valley including areas like Oakville, Atlas Peak, Pritchard Hill, Silverado Bench, Coombsville, plus the Russian River Valley for Chardonnay. Just wrapping up this year’s harvest, Ralph said, “2021 may go down as an excellent vintage. We can’t be sure but so far everything is aligned beautifully.” “The 2021 Merlot is tasting fantastic, really elegant. It’s probably some of the best Merlot we’ve ever gotten from the Rockwell Ridge Vineyard.” Ralph and his team just picked seven tons of Cabernet Sauvignon, from the Atlas Peak area, where the vines are 21 years old and have a fantastic clone/rootstock combination producing ultra premium fruit. “Petit Verdot is showing to be incredibly gorgeous this year, tastes delicious,” Ralph said excitedly. “Do you love blueberry notes in your Cabernet? I love it! It’s incredibly exotic, it’s intriguing, it’s gorgeous. It adds that extra layer for me…where my mind gets blown. Petit Verdot is a major contributor to that so I use quite a bit of Petit Verdot in my program.”

High Praises Six years following the original Hertelendy release, Ralph Hertelendy is recognized as one of Napa’s premier winemakers. All of his wines, be it Cabernet Sauvignon, Cabernet Franc, his elegant Chardonnay or blends, consistently receive accolades and high ratings. Larkmead Vineyards One of Napa’s Great Legends

With origins dating back to 1895, Larkmead Vineyards’ history is centered around several past generations. Like many of Napa’s great legends, each story tells of bygone days when families settled in Napa’s rich fertile valley with dreams of success and a love of wine instilled in them from the old country. Larkmead’s legendary past is much the same, paying tribute to the Coit, Salmina, and Solari families, and now present-day proprietors Cam and Kate Solari-Baker. Kate’s parents, Larry and Polly Solari, owned the winery from 19481992 and passed down a legacy rooted in strong viticultural philosophies honoring the diversity of centuries-old riverbed soils at the 110-acre site. By continuing to vinify small lots according to clonal selection and soil type, the subtle nuances and complexities of each block and varietal are celebrated as well as preserved for the next generation to come.

A Sense of Place Born from a single parcel of vines, each with its own unique soil profile, the Larkmead wines represent true sitespecific winemaking at its best. Primarily focusing on finely crafted Cabernet Sauvignon and reds, the estate soils of gravel, clay, and loam are the calling card for each bottling. Their Firebelle, a Merlot named after Lillie Hitchcock Coit, America’s first female firefighter, masks as a cabernet with firm structure and power from the Bordeaux-style varieties

in the blend yet beguiles with its core of soft, plush merlot fruit. Another impressive shapeshifter, Lillie, a distinguished Sauvignon Blanc, entices with varietally correct aromatics then seamlessly transitions to the weight and refinement of a top-notch Chardonnay.

Living “Green” As one of the oldest family-owned wineries in Napa Valley, the importance of longevity through sustainability has guided Cam and Kate’s transformation of the historic vineyard into a world-class wine estate. Both the interior and exterior spaces were re-designed in 2006 to purposefully respect their natural environment. Green farming methods have been an inherent practice for decades, culminating in recent “Napa Green Certified Winery” and “Napa Green Land” certifications. Their daughter Ann Baker, a MS in Landscape Architecture, brought back pollinators like bees, butterflies and hummingbirds by planting native species throughout the estate. A seasonal waterway restoration project spearheaded by Ann now allows steelhead to return and spawn in the newly fortified eddies and pools. To reinforce the singular expression of terroir even further in each wine, Cam and Kate built a state-of-the-art, eco-friendly cellar, complete with dedicated vinification tanks to house individual vineyard blocks during the winemaking process. Tips on

Wine Tasting

Visiting a winery tasting room may sometimes be intimidating, especially if you are not used to wine tasting and aren’t quite sure what to expect. Additionally, Covid-19 has made it necessary for some changes and adaptations. Following the guidelines and etiquette tips below will help enhance your experience as you travel through wine country. Due to Covid-19, there have been changes to the wine tasting adventures. So please before you go:

• Plan in advance. Most wineries are now by appointment and in some cases “as space is available” (should you not have made reservations). Don’t be shy to ask at the last minute, but understand they may be full or be reserved. • Understand that there may be a time limit • Ask about the different tasting experiences and costs. • If you plan to “share” a tasting, ask if it is okay. You may still be charged per person. • If this applies, ask if the winery is dog/child friendly. • Be sure to adhere to individual, local and state guidelines in place at the time (i.e. mask wearing until seated, etc.)

VISIT NAPA VALLEY/DAVID COLLIER

• Be flexible Covid-19 has had many positive effects for wine tasting: More intimate, less crowded, more time to really talk to your winery host. With this is mind-LET’S GO TASTING AND HAVE FUN! • Don’t be self-conscious to share a tasting (*if appropriate) with your companion – it’s not looked on as being cheap, in fact, it’s smart.

• Don’t worry if you think you don’t know good wine. “Good wine” is what you like. Period. • You don’t have to finish the glass. You are tasting, not drinking – use the dump bucket. Those little sips add up fast. • You don’t have to like everything poured. The reason you are tasting is to see what you do and don’t like. • Take time to smell the roses, or wine! Swirl the wine in the bowl of the glass then take your time, put your nose into the bowl of the glass … and inhale to experience the bouquet. See what fragrances you can identify: Earthy? Lemon? Honeysuckle? Cherry? Tobacco? It’s okay if you don’t identify any of those things, with time and tasting you will!

• Remember the five “S’s” of wine tasting: See (the wine in the glass), Swirl, Smell, Sip and Savor. (Take a small sip. Let the liquid surround your taste buds, what flavors can you identify)? • Ask questions! Remember … there are no stupid questions. You are there to enjoy and learn, and your server is there to help. • Don’t feel pressured to buy a bottle or to join a wine club, (however, if the tasting is free, or if you have a private tasting with a winemaker, it is good form to purchase a bottle). • Leave a tip if you have had a nice experience ($5-$20 is a general rule, depending on the type of tasting).

GOOD TO KNOW • Acidity: The level of natural acids in a wine that give it freshness and crispness on the palate. • American Viticultural Area (AVA): A government-approved winegrowing region whose geological and climatic conditions create wines of distinction. A specific appellation of origin. • Body: A term used to describe the weight of a wine on the palate. • Bouquet: A term for the fragrance of a wine developed after it has been aged. Sometimes used interchangeably with “aroma,” which is technically the fragrance of a wine before aging.

• Brix: A grape ripeness scale, used primarily in the U.S., that measures solids (sugars) inside the juice of a grape. • Cap: The top surface of the must, where solids accumulate and are then pushed back down (punched down) into the juice to increase skin contact. • Crush: Harvest season that starts with picking grapes and ends months later with the transfer of wine to barrel. • Cuvée: A Champagne house’s best offering, usually made from the first pressing of grapes; A • Estate-bottled: The wine was under the control of the producer, start to finish.

• Fermentation: The transformation of grape juice into wine as sugar plus yeast convert to alcohol and carbon dioxide (and heat).

• Finish: The impression a wine leaves on the palate after swallowing or spitting. • Lees: Dead yeast cells from fermentation that settle at the bottom of a barrel or tank. When stirred in the wine, as done during the aging of Chardonnay, lees add body and creaminess. • Legs: Streams of wine that run down the inside wall of a wine glass. Narrow, fast-moving legs generally indicate low alcohol content and light body, while wide, slow legs usually mean richness and higher alcohol. • Maceration: A time period that allows grape skins to make contact with grape juice, usually before fermentation begins, in order to develop deeper color in the finished wine. • Meritage: The unique American term for a Bordeaux-style blended red wine made in the U.S. from two or more of the five classic red grapes of Bordeaux. Not more than 90% of a single grape can make up a wine labeled as Meritage. • Must: The mixture of unfermented grape juice with the solids from skins, stems and seeds of the grapes. • Nose: A term to describe how a wine smells, sometimes used in place of “aroma.”

• Reserve: Term used by a producer that usually indicates a wine ranked among their highest tier of quality. • Sediment: Residue accumulated during extended aging of a bottle of wine. Red wine sediment is formed by color pigments, tannin molecules and tartrates. White wine can sometimes show sediment of tartrates that appear as crystals. • Sulfites: Chemical compounds of sulfur that act as a preservative in wine.

• Tannin: A primary component in red wine, it is a chemical compound (phenolic) developed in wine when fermenting juice makes extended contact with skins, seeds and stems; also added to wine as it ages in contact with oak. At an elevated level, tannin gives wine a dryness on the palate and causes the mouth to pucker (astringency), but when balanced with other components it provides the necessary structure that gives texture and grip.

• Terroir: The accumulation of all conditions surrounding a grape-growing site, including soil, sunlight, daytime an nighttime temperatures, rainfall, drainage, elevation, etc., all contributing to each wine’s uniqueness.
